PepsiCo has named Albert Carey as Frito-Lay North America (FLNA) division’s new president and CEO. He succeeds Irene Rosenfeld, who left to join Kraft Foods yesterday (26 June), with immediate effect.


Carey is a 25-year veteran of PepsiCo and has spent nearly 20 years at FLNA. He most recently served as the president of PepsiCo sales, and his replacement there will be named soon, the company said.


“Al Carey is recognised industry-wide for his command not only of PepsiCo’s businesses and our strong go-to-market capabilities, but for his passionate commitment to our customers and the consumers they serve, and the thousands of associates who bring PepsiCo to them every day,” said PepsiCo chairman and CEO, Steve Reinemund.


During his long spell at Pepsi, Carey has held a broad range of positions at Frito-Lay, including chief operating officer, as well as chief operating officer for PepsiCo beverages and foods, senior vice president of sales and retailer strategies for PepsiCo, and senior vice president of sales for Pepsi-Cola North America.
